McDonald’s near Penn Station where teenage tourist stabbed in ‘unprovoked’ attack

A 19-year-old Australian tourist was stabbed and seriously wounded in an unprovoked attack at a Midtown Manhattan McDonald’s early Monday, police and law enforcement sources said. The victim was sitting and eating inside the fast-food eatery on Eighth Avenue near Penn Station around 2 a.m. when he was stabbed in the rib cage and the back, the sources said. Words were exchanged between the victim and his attacker, but sources said the horrifying attack was largely unprovoked.
